Chapter 100: Chapter 100: Slaying the Tier Two Demon Snake
He didn’t rush to continue exploring the underground area.
Li Ping and Daoist Ji used the Array to return to the surface of Little Plum Mountain from underground.
Li Ping thought that Daoist Ji’s mischievous, bird-nest-robbing grandson, who had accidentally stumbled upon the Underground Spirit Vein, must be blessed with great fortune.
After asking Daoist Ji, he learned that this grandson was also a Cultivator with a Spiritual Root—in fact, he had Four Spirit Roots, just like Ji Shu Xuan.
Originally, given the boy’s restless nature, Daoist Ji had wanted to send him to the Immortal City to travel and cultivate under Li Ping, while the mild-mannered Ji Shu Xuan would have stayed to cultivate within the family.
But because the boy had discovered the Underground Spirit Vein, Daoist Ji no longer dared to let him leave the house.
After all, children are naive. If he accidentally let it slip and an outsider learned of the matter, it would bring utter destruction upon the Ji family.
So now, his grandson could only stay obediently at home, kept under the strict watch of his grandfather, father, and uncle—three Middle-stage Qi Refining Cultivators.
Li Ping nodded slightly. "Daoist Ji, in other words, besides me, only the four of you know about the Underground Spirit Vein, correct?"
Li Ping strongly approved of Daoist Ji’s handling of the situation.
When it came to secrets, the fewer people who knew, the better.
Someone like Ji Shuwen, who had been sent to the Crimson Flame Sect to cultivate, was too young and in an unfamiliar environment. It would be hard to say if she could keep such a secret.
Daoist Ji sighed. "How could I dare to speak of such a secret to anyone?"
"Good." Li Ping nodded with a smile. "Then in a little while, I’ll go down and kill that Demon Snake. I’ll have to ask you to stand guard for me, Daoist Ji!"
"Alright!"
...
About half a day later, Li Ping and Daoist Ji were advancing slowly through the underground passage, having walked for nearly two miles.
Li Ping’s nostrils twitched as he caught a foul, stenchy odor from up ahead.
Daoist Ji sent a low-voiced transmission to remind him, "Be careful, Brother Li. That Demon Snake is coiled up not far ahead."
Li Ping didn’t dare to be careless. He gave a solemn nod and then said, "Daoist Ji, you should rest here for now. I’ll go ahead alone and take a look."
Once Li Ping began fighting the Demon Snake, he might not be able to look out for him. Daoist Ji only had a Middle-stage Qi Refining cultivation and couldn’t be of much help. In fact, he could easily be injured by the aftershocks of their battle.
So, it was best for him to stay here and not advance any further.
Worry filled Daoist Ji’s eyes as he urged, "Alright. You be careful too, Brother Li. If things look bad, retreat immediately!"
Li Ping nodded and then darted forward.
Generally speaking, because they lacked intelligence, Demon Beasts of a certain tier were usually not as powerful as Cultivators of the same tier.
Li Ping possessed two Tier Two Upper Grade Dharma Artifacts—one for offense and one for defense—and also had many Tier Two Middle Grade Spirit Talismans. His combat power far exceeded that of his peers, so he naturally had no fear of a Demon Snake of the same tier.
SWISH!
A streak of fire shot from Li Ping’s hand and affixed itself to the ceiling of the underground passage, illuminating the tunnel as brightly as day.
Not far away, a ferocious-looking Demon Snake, fifty to sixty feet long and as thick as a water barrel, appeared in Li Ping’s field of vision.
His Divine Sense enveloped the Demon Snake, and Li Ping immediately recognized it. It was a Tier Two Middle Grade Flower-Scaled Python.
The flare of light also startled the coiled, resting python. Sensing Li Ping’s approach, it flicked its forked tongue and hissed a warning, trying to drive him away, but it didn’t move from its spot to attack.
’Strange, is this Demon Snake guarding something?’ Li Ping wondered.
All things in the world possessed spirit, and Demon Beasts were no exception. Although they lacked intelligence, they knew that natural Spiritual Objects were greatly beneficial to them.
For example, the Spiritual Objects growing in the Cloud Mist Mountain Range were usually guarded by Demon Beasts, which would devour them once they matured.
If humans wanted to harvest these Spiritual Objects, they had to either drive the Demon Beasts away or kill them outright.
The thought flashed through his mind, and without hesitation, Li Ping slapped his Storage Bag. A crimson light and a purple light flew out.
The crimson light spun and transformed into a shield as tall as a man, hovering before him. The purple light instantly became a two-foot-long Flying Sword that shot viciously toward the Flower-Scaled Python.
"HISS~"
As the Flying Sword closed in, the Flower-Scaled Python sensed the danger and let out a sharp hiss, spitting a jet of green light toward the Purple Shadow sword.
Unsure of what it was, Li Ping didn’t dare let his Flying Sword be hit. He quickly used his Divine Sense to maneuver the sword out of the way. The green light missed the sword and struck the gray rock wall instead.
Instantly—
"SIZZLE~"
A large chunk of the rock was instantly corroded away, and a dizzying, foul stench began to fill the air.
Only then did Li Ping see clearly that the green light the Flower-Scaled Python had spat out was actually a glob of venom!
Just then, he also smelled the foul odor and immediately felt a wave of nausea.
Clearly, he had been poisoned.
Li Ping frowned slightly. With a mere circulation of the Nourishing Life Skill Power within him, the poison was purged from his body.
Then, he unhesitatingly continued to control the Flying Sword, sending it slashing toward the Flower-Scaled Python.
BANG!
It seemed that spitting venom took a considerable toll. The Flower-Scaled Python didn’t spit more venom to block the Flying Sword. Instead, it whipped its tail, lashing out at the sword with incredible speed.
But Li Ping’s Flying Sword was of Tier Two Upper Grade quality; how could it be so easily blocked?
The python’s tail collided with the Flying Sword. The sword was knocked away, but the python’s tail was left a bloody mess.
"HISS~"
Injured, the Flower-Scaled Python’s eyes flashed with a hateful green light. It stared fiercely in Li Ping’s direction, then suddenly opened its fanged maw and charged at him.
A RUMBLE echoed through the air as it moved.
Li Ping hurriedly maneuvered his Red Armor Shield to block it. As he injected Magical Power, a layer of red mist appeared on the shield’s surface.
BANG!
The Demon Snake slammed headfirst into the Red Armor Shield. The tremendous impact instantly shattered the layer of red mist, but the shield itself didn’t budge, completely blocking the snake’s attack.
The Demon Snake, on the other hand, was momentarily stunned by the collision.
’A perfect chance!’ Li Ping would certainly not miss this opportunity. He reflexively formed a Sword Technique with his hands.
The Purple Shadow Flying Sword whistled through the air, slashing at the Demon Snake’s neck. If this strike landed true, it would undoubtedly decapitate the snake, killing it instantly.
However, the Demon Snake was, after all, a Tier Two Mid-stage beast. Sensing the biting chill from the Purple Shadow sword, it violently twisted its body, avoiding a fatal blow to its neck. The purple light streaked across its midsection, tearing open a massive gash!
Instantly, blood gushed out like a waterfall, staining the tunnel walls crimson.
The foul stench in the air grew even more intense. Apparently, the Demon Snake’s blood was also highly toxic!
But with the protection of his Nourishing Life Skill Power, Li Ping naturally had no fear of the snake’s venom.
He continued to command the Flying Sword to slash at the Demon Snake, hacking its body to a bloody pulp. The blood flowing from the snake also corroded the tunnel walls, leaving them pitted and pockmarked.
At this moment, feeling its life force draining away, the Demon Snake finally realized the gap in strength between itself and Li Ping. It knew that continuing to fight meant certain death. A flicker of fear appeared in its eyes as it twisted its body and retreated, attempting to flee.
But at this point, how could Li Ping possibly let it escape?
With a soft shout, he stepped directly onto the blood-soaked ground and strode in pursuit. Forming a hand seal, he sent the Purple Shadow sword whistling after the Demon Snake. The cold light circled once, and in an instant, the snake’s neck was severed.
THUD!
Decapitated, the Demon Snake’s lifeless body crashed to the ground.
Its ferocious head flew through the air, tumbling end over end, slammed against the tunnel wall, and bounced a few more times before falling silent.
And with that, the Tier Two Mid-stage Flower-Scaled Python was dead at Li Ping’s hands.
...
Seeing the Demon Snake decapitated, Li Ping couldn’t help but breathe a sigh of relief.
Back when he was adventuring in the Immortal City, he had killed many Tier One Demon Beasts, but this was the first time he had killed a Tier Two Demon Beast.
In truth, this Flower-Scaled Python wasn’t weak. Its entire body was saturated with a potent poison, strong enough to affect even a Foundation Establishment Cultivator. If another Foundation Establishment Cultivator had come, they would have had to retreat in defeat when faced with such a toxic environment, unless they possessed an antidote-type Treasure.
But Li Ping was different. He was protected by his Nourishing Life Skill Power, making him virtually immune to all poisons.
So, in reality, he was its natural counter. The Flower-Scaled Python’s greatest weapon—its poison—had no effect on him, leaving it with only one possible fate: to be slain by him!
After resting for a moment, Li Ping frowned at the corroded, pockmarked tunnel around him. In such a toxic environment, never mind Daoist Ji, even a Foundation Establishment Cultivator would likely be affected.
SWOOSH!
With a wave of his hand, a Fireball shot out. The rising flames instantly burned away the blood and venom on the tunnel walls, and the air filled with a scorched, acrid smell.
Only after the flames had burned away all the toxins in the air did Li Ping use his Divine Sense to inform Daoist Ji that it was safe to come over.
The fifty-to-sixty-foot-long snake’s body lay limp on the ground, while its ferocious, barrel-sized head rested several yards away. Only a figure in green robes stood proudly amidst the scene.
This was the scene that greeted Daoist Ji when he arrived.
He spoke in disbelief, "This Tier Two Demon Snake is... just dead? Brother Li, are you alright?!"
Li Ping smiled and waved his hand. "It was just a mere Demon Snake. How could anything happen to me? By the way, Daoist Ji, let’s harvest the materials from this Demon Snake together."
The Flower-Scaled Python’s flesh and blood were highly toxic, so Daoist Ji was extremely careful as he began to harvest it.
Li Ping, however, wasn’t concerned about the poison. With swift movements of his knife, he stripped off the Flower-Scaled Python’s skin and Scale Armor—both excellent materials for refining Dharma Artifacts.
Besides the skin and armor, the Flower-Scaled Python’s Snake Gallbladder could be used to refine Cultivation Elixirs, making it a precious Spiritual Object as well.
But the most valuable parts of the entire Flower-Scaled Python were actually its pair of fangs.
Li Ping had already witnessed the lethality of this Demon Snake’s venom during the battle. When he was gathering materials, he certainly wasn’t going to pass up its fangs.
In fact, the fangs were what he cared about the most.
He took the pair of fangs for himself.
As for the other materials like the skin, Scale Armor, and Snake Gallbladder, he didn’t care for them at all and gave them directly to Daoist Ji.
Li Ping planned to refine the fangs into a set of Flying Needle Dharma Artifacts. Flying Needles were already known for being insidious and difficult to defend against. If a potent poison was added, they would become the ultimate weapon for sneak attacks.
Aside from the most valuable fangs, the Flower-Scaled Python’s skin and armor could be used to refine Tier One Upper Grade Dharma Artifacts.
Hearing that Li Ping intended to give all these materials to him, Daoist Ji repeatedly refused.
But under Li Ping’s insistence, he ultimately had no choice but to accept them.
